Worms and Lasers: A Fascinating Story

In order to better understand the neuronal origins of human behavior, scientists from Harvard University studied the response of Celegans (transparent nematodes – worms) to the application of strategically applied laser beams. These Celegans have a well mapped, but simple nervous system which can serve as an adequate model for researching the human nervous system.…

Ophir Photonics’ BeamGage® Laser BeamAnalysis Software Adds Support for 64-bit Processing & Large Format Cameras

May 2, 2011 – Logan, UT – Ophir Photonics Group, the global leader in precision laser measurement equipment, today announced BeamGage® version 5.5, the company’s next generation laser beam analysis software. The new version supports 64-bit versions of Windows® Vista and Windows 7, as well as the USB L11058 Large Format Beam Profiling Camera. The…
